    About Julie Hubbard, PT, DPT, MS, CSCS

    Julie has an extensive athletics background having played NCAA Division I soccer at both Penn State and UConn. During her six-year college tenure, she tallied various musculoskeletal injuries including multiple ACL tears. These hardships ultimately propelled her into the field of sports medicine, where she earned her clinical doctorate in physical therapy from Northeastern University.

    Throughout her career, Julie has worked with hundreds of high school, college, and professional athletes. She aims to help people of all ages and abilities reach their rehabilitation and sport performance goals, but is particularly passionate about helping injured athletes return to sport after ACL reconstruction. This has ultimately led her to found the New England Return to Sport Center, whose mission is to provide premier out-of-network sports physical therapy and injury prevention services to athletes around the state of Massachusetts.

    Julie is an NSCA Certified Strength and Conditioning Specialist (CSCS). She has also acquired her certifications in Dry Needling for Orthopedic Rehabilitation and Sport Performance (Structure & Function), Sportsmetrics ACL Injury Prevention, Selective Functional Movement Assessment (SFMA), and Personalized Blood Flow Restriction (Owens Recovery Science). She believes in empowering her patients with the self-efficacy needed to optimize recovery. While she enjoys implementing manual therapies, she particularly values the utilization of therapeutic exercise. She appreciates staying current with the literature and applies evidence-informed techniques to practice daily.
